Strong University offers for Upper Sixth

Haberdashers’ Boys remain at the forefront of university admission.  All our Upper Sixth Form boys have opted to progress to tertiary education (some are taking gap years), virtually all of whom are already holding an offer.

36 boys have been accepted to Oxford and Cambridge (assuming they achieve their predicted grades).  Other destinations include the universities of Nottingham (57 offers), Birmingham (40 offers), Manchester (31 offers), as well as substantial offers from Bristol, Durham, Edinburgh, Imperial, Kings, UCL and Warwick.


We wish our boys the best of luck in their examinations, and know that they bring us enormous credit when they take up their places.  One recent leaver noted that he felt the intellectual challenge had been much greater at Habs than it was at his current (prestigious) university.
